Step into a different rhythm of life at Gofindyourself Yoga, set within The Himalayan Orchard, a 75-year-old farmhouse in Rukhla. This isn't a sterile retreat center, but a living, breathing home and working farmstead that has evolved organically over decades. You'll become part of its rhythm, sharing meals around a communal table, warming by woodfires, and embarking on long walks through the surrounding landscape. Each room possesses its own distinct character, shaped by history and a deep appreciation for quaint beauty, offering warmth, simplicity, and thoughtful details rather than uniform polish. It’s a place to reconnect with a more grounded existence, far from the demands of modern life.

How to get there

To reach Gofindyourself Yoga, fly into Chandigarh (Shaheed Bhagat Singh International Airport, IXC). From the airport, you will need to take a taxi directly to Himalayan Orchard, Rukhla. The taxi journey typically takes around 6 hours.
